一、移动开发设备管理系统的背景和意义
在当今数字化时代,移动应用开发变得越来越普遍。无论是小型创业公司还是大型企业,都在积极开发自己的移动应用。而在移动开发过程中,会涉及到各种各样的设备,像不同品牌、型号的手机、平板电脑等。这些设备对于开发人员来说,就像是战场上的武器,重要性不言而喻。
提高开发效率:想象一下,开发团队里有多个开发人员,他们都需要使用不同的设备进行测试。如果没有一个有效的管理系统,大家可能会为了找设备而浪费很多时间。有了移动开发设备管理系统,开发人员可以快速知道哪些设备可用,直接去取用,大大提高了开发效率。
保证设备安全:设备里面可能存储着公司重要的开发数据和代码。通过管理系统,可以对设备的使用权限进行设置,只有授权的人员才能使用,避免数据泄露等安全问题。
降低成本:合理的设备管理可以避免重复采购设备。系统可以清晰记录设备的使用情况和状态,根据实际需求进行设备的调配,减少不必要的开支。

二、系统功能设计
设备信息管理:这个功能就像是设备的“身份证”管理。要记录设备的基本信息,比如品牌、型号、颜色、购买时间、价格等。还可以记录设备的硬件配置,像内存大小、处理器型号等。这样开发人员在选择设备时,可以根据自己的需求快速筛选。例如,开发一个对内存要求较高的游戏应用,就可以直接找到内存大的设备进行测试。
设备借用与归还管理:开发人员需要使用设备时,可以在系统里提交借用申请。管理员审核通过后,开发人员就可以去取设备。归还时,也在系统里进行登记。系统会记录借用和归还的时间,方便统计设备的使用时长。比如,如果某个设备长时间被占用,管理员可以根据情况进行调配,让更多人有机会使用。
设备维护管理:设备使用久了可能会出现各种问题,需要进行维护。系统可以记录设备的维护历史,包括维护时间、维护内容、维护人员等。还可以设置维护提醒,当设备达到一定的使用时长或者出现某些故障迹象时,系统自动提醒管理员进行维护。例如,手机电池续航能力下降,系统提醒管理员及时更换电池。
设备状态监控:实时监控设备的状态,比如是否在线、电量情况等。如果设备电量低,系统可以及时提醒开发人员充电。还可以监控设备的性能指标,如CPU使用率、内存使用率等,了解设备的运行状况。
三、系统架构设计
客户端:开发人员和管理员可以通过客户端来使用系统。客户端可以是网页端或者手机APP。开发人员可以在客户端上查看设备信息、提交借用申请等。管理员可以在客户端上进行设备信息的录入、审核借用申请、查看设备状态等操作。比如,开发人员在外出时,也可以通过手机APP查看设备是否可用,提交借用申请。
服务器端:服务器端负责处理客户端的请求,对数据进行存储和管理。它就像是系统的“大脑”,协调各个功能模块的运行。服务器端需要具备高可用性和稳定性,以保证系统的正常运行。例如,当多个开发人员同时提交借用申请时,服务器端要能够快速处理这些请求。
数据库:数据库用于存储系统的各种数据,包括设备信息、借用记录、维护记录等。要选择合适的数据库管理系统,保证数据的安全性和完整性。比如,可以选择MySQL数据库,它具有高性能、可靠性强等特点。
四、系统安全设计
用户认证与授权:只有经过认证的用户才能登录系统。可以采用用户名和密码的方式进行认证,也可以结合短信验证码等方式提高安全性。不同的用户有不同的权限,开发人员只能进行设备的借用和归还操作,管理员可以进行设备信息的管理、审核等操作。例如,普通开发人员不能修改设备的基本信息,只有管理员才有这个权限。
数据加密:对系统中存储的重要数据进行加密处理,比如设备的配置信息、开发数据等。即使数据被非法获取,没有解密密钥也无法查看。可以采用对称加密和非对称加密相结合的方式,提高数据的安全性。
访问控制:限制对系统资源的访问。可以设置不同的访问级别,只有授权的用户才能访问特定的功能模块。例如,只有管理员才能访问设备维护管理模块,开发人员只能访问设备借用与归还管理模块。
五、建米软件的推荐
在设计和实施移动开发设备管理系统时,可能会遇到各种问题,比如系统功能不够完善、操作复杂等。这时候可以试试建米软件,它能很好地解决这些问题。建米软件的设备管理功能非常强大,操作也很简单,开发人员和管理员都能快速上手。它可以对设备进行全面的管理,包括设备信息、借用归还、维护等,让移动开发设备管理变得更加轻松高效。
以上就是关于移动开发设备管理系统设计的一些内容,希望对大家有所帮助。在实际设计过程中,还需要根据具体的需求和情况进行调整和优化。
常见用户关注的问题:
一、移动开发设备管理系统设计难不难?
我就想知道,这移动开发设备管理系统设计到底难不难呀。感觉涉及到好多方面呢,应该不简单吧。
系统架构设计方面:要考虑系统的整体结构,像采用什么样的分层架构,是三层架构还是微服务架构,这得根据系统的规模和需求来定。而且不同的架构设计对后续的开发、维护和扩展都有很大影响。建米软件在系统架构设计上有丰富的经验,能根据不同企业的需求设计出合理的架构。
设备兼容性问题:现在市场上移动设备种类繁多,不同品牌、型号、操作系统版本都不一样。要让系统能兼容各种设备,就得进行大量的测试和适配工作。比如有些老版本的设备可能性能有限,系统在上面运行可能会卡顿,这就需要优化代码。
安全设计:移动设备管理系统涉及到企业的重要数据和信息,安全问题至关重要。要防止数据泄露、恶意攻击等。比如要设计合理的用户认证和授权机制,对数据进行加密处理。建米软件在安全设计方面有一套成熟的方案,能保障系统的安全性。
功能需求实现:系统要满足企业对设备管理的各种功能需求,像设备的添加、删除、修改信息,设备的使用状态监控等。每个功能的实现都需要编写相应的代码,还要保证功能之间的协同工作。
用户体验设计:一个好的系统不仅要功能强大,还要有良好的用户体验。界面设计要简洁美观、操作方便,让用户能轻松上手。这就需要考虑用户的使用习惯和心理。
二、移动开发设备管理系统有啥用?
我听说移动开发设备管理系统挺有用的,就是不太清楚具体有啥用。感觉应该能给企业带来不少便利吧。
设备集中管理:企业可能有大量的移动设备,通过这个系统可以把这些设备集中管理起来。可以随时查看设备的基本信息,比如设备的型号、购买时间、使用人等。建米软件的移动开发设备管理系统能实现高效的设备集中管理。
提高设备使用效率:系统可以监控设备的使用状态,了解设备是否闲置或者使用频率过高。这样就能合理调配设备,避免设备的浪费,提高设备的使用效率。
保障数据安全:移动设备上可能存储着企业的重要数据,系统可以对数据进行加密和备份,防止数据丢失和泄露。还可以设置访问权限,只有授权的人员才能访问特定的数据。
降低管理成本:传统的设备管理方式可能需要大量的人力和物力,而使用移动开发设备管理系统可以减少人工操作,降低管理成本。比如设备的维修和保养提醒功能,可以及时发现设备问题并进行处理,避免设备损坏带来的更大损失。
方便员工使用:员工可以通过系统快速申请使用设备,查询设备的使用情况。而且系统可以提供一些自助服务,比如设备的简单故障排查和解决方法,方便员工自己解决一些小问题。

| 功能 | 描述 | 优势 |
|---|---|---|
| 设备集中管理 | 将企业所有移动设备信息集中存储和管理 | 方便查询和统计设备信息 |
| 使用状态监控 | 实时监控设备的使用情况 | 合理调配设备,提高使用效率 |
| 数据安全保障 | 对设备数据进行加密和备份 | 防止数据丢失和泄露 |
三、移动开发设备管理系统要多少钱?
朋友说移动开发设备管理系统价格差别挺大的,我就想知道到底要多少钱呢。这价格肯定和好多因素有关吧。
功能复杂度:系统的功能越多、越复杂,开发成本就越高,价格也就越贵。比如一个只具备基本设备管理功能的系统和一个包含设备监控、数据分析等高级功能的系统,价格肯定不一样。建米软件可以根据企业的需求定制不同功能的系统,价格也会根据功能来定。
开发方式:如果是定制开发,需要根据企业的具体需求进行个性化设计和开发,价格相对较高。而如果是使用现成的模板进行二次开发,价格会相对便宜一些。
用户数量:系统的使用用户数量也会影响价格。如果企业员工数量多,需要更多的用户账号和并发处理能力,价格可能会相应提高。
服务内容:除了系统开发费用,还可能涉及到后期的维护、升级、培训等服务费用。一些软件公司会提供不同的服务套餐,价格也会有所不同。
市场竞争:市场上移动开发设备管理系统的供应商很多,竞争也比较激烈。不同供应商的定价策略也不一样,企业可以多比较几家,选择性价比高的产品。
| 影响因素 | 具体情况 | 对价格的影响 |
|---|---|---|
| 功能复杂度 | 功能多且复杂 | 价格高 |
| 开发方式 | 定制开发 | 价格高 |
| 用户数量 | 用户数量多 | 价格可能提高 |
四、怎么选移动开发设备管理系统?
朋友推荐了一些移动开发设备管理系统,但是我还是不太清楚怎么选。感觉要考虑好多方面呢。
功能是否满足需求:要明确企业对设备管理的具体需求,比如是否需要设备定位功能、是否需要与其他系统集成等。选择的系统功能要能满足企业的实际需求。建米软件的系统功能丰富,可以根据企业需求进行定制。
系统稳定性:系统要能稳定运行,不能经常出现故障。可以了解软件公司的技术实力和过往项目经验,看看他们开发的系统是否稳定可靠。
用户体验:一个好的系统应该有良好的用户体验,界面设计要简洁美观、操作方便。可以要求软件公司提供试用版,让员工试用一下,看看是否容易上手。
安全性能:由于系统涉及到企业的重要数据,安全性能至关重要。要了解系统采用了哪些安全技术,比如数据加密、用户认证等。
售后服务:选择系统时要考虑软件公司的售后服务质量。包括系统的维护、升级、技术支持等。一个好的售后服务能保证系统的正常运行。
阅读时间:
12分钟
浏览量:次


